AWS welder

I am shooting JSB 18.1gr @ 1,030-1,050FPS with great results…It is
not unusual to see 1/2 groups at 65yds….Do a little experimenting
with how you are holding the rifle and also try putting the gun on
something more stable than just the tripod. Follow through trying to
keep the crosshairs on the POI until after you hear the pellet hit…
I think you will find that it is hard to do….If the groups tighten up
while the gun is stabilized then you will know it is not the gun…..
I have seen times when I have shot 10 rounds with the same point
of aim, with 2 different holds and had 2 seperate 1/2 groups.

Also double check you barrel set screws and make sure the tank
stays screwed in tight….

Try the 28 gr for the condor. At those speeds any little variation in the pellet becomes magnified, any breeze might shift them. The 21 gr might work but I stick with the 28gr, the 32gr are a tight fit in the barrel and some people like them, I dont care to have to pop them in the barrel every shot. All an all there’s a lot of things that affect tight groups. It takes a while for each person to tweek out all the things that might be affecting them.

I’m no expert, and perhaps some one will correct me if I’m wrong, but your probably pushing those premiers past the speed of sound and loosing stability because of it. The heavier pellets have a better BC. Mine loves the EJ’s and it is less accurate with the lighter pellets.
